Coffee is decent albeit overpriced. Do not come here if you are in a hurry. Expect to wait at least 15-20 minutes for your drinks. It is a slow laid back type of coffee joint. Vibe is good.
Saturday night at 8pm, there was one barista. There were 2 customers in line ahead of us, the 4 of us, then 4 after us. That's 10 drink orders to take BEFORE the poor guy could start on the drinks. Needless to say, it took a while. They're priced a bit on the high side - we got 2 med drinks + tax & tip for $20. BUT the drinks were great. The biggest issue? The music was heavy metal and not good for the coffee shop vibe at all. We weren't relaxed by the tunes and it just was stressful. (The back room was quiet, but no room for us to hang there - Hmmm, I wonder why?). Will I return? Great coffee will bring me back for another try.

There is a unique selection of lattes, teas, and coffee. I always try something unique, something I've never had before, and all of their drinks are delicious.
There are a lot of plants and many different seating options. The back room has amazing ambiance, and the entire space is pretty cozy and a great place to gather.
Additionally, this space has attracted many different types of laid back and welcoming people. Catholics, gays, and Bahais will all gather here and everyone is chill.
